EAGLE-EYED football fans were in hysterics after spotting William Saliba’s celebration which left a ballboy fuming.
The Arsenal defender headed his side in front at home to Chelsea on Sunday afternoon.

But after Piero Hincapie nodded into his own net, – from yet another corner.
And Saliba could not contain his excitement.
As the TV cameras focused on , he was followed towards the corner by the towering centre-back.
Then Saliba spotted a spare football on a cone being looked after by one of the ballboys.
So in his joy, he absolutely leathered it high into the Emirates stand.
But the ballboy was not happy.
Firstly, he understandably jumped out of his skin, flinching hard at the fear of being hit by the flying football.
And then he appeared to let his frustration clear as the ball he was in charge of looking after went flying off into the distance by throwing his arms in the air.
It was reminiscent of the Year 11 lads mercilessly and needlessly launching the Year 7s’ football away during lunchtime in the school playground.
And the hilarious incident was spotted by some fans watching the action on TV.
One said: “Ballboy wasn’t too pleased with Saliba.”

DEFENDERS were on top as Arsenal headed their way past Chelsea to extend their lead in the Premier League table to five points.
William Saliba combined with Gabriel Magalhaes as the hosts netted yet another goal from a corner.
Jurrien Timber headed Arsenal back in front and secured the points after some abysmal goalkeeping from Robert Sanchez.
Arsenal will now turn their attentions to the next Premier League fixture at Brighton on Wednesday.
Mikel Arteta’s side have put the pressure back on the chasing pack as the title race enters the home straight.
